Surgical Exposure (Gingivoplasty) of Unerupted #13

Surgical Procedure

Chief Complaint

Patient presented with concern of unerupted upper right canine (#13).

Clinical Findings

  • #23 (upper left canine) fully erupted.

  • #13 unerupted, covered by thick gingival tissue.

  • Eruption delayed and unable to match contra-lateral #23.

  • #13 positioned below gingival margin of #12.

Treatment Plan

  • Surgical exposure (gingivoplasty) of unerupted #13 to facilitate and accelerate eruption.

  • Risks, benefits, and procedures explained to patient and mother.

  • Quotation provided.

  • Informed consent obtained.

Pre-operative Assessment

  • Pre-op photographs taken.

  • No signs of active infection.

  • Medical history unremarkable.

Anesthesia

Local infiltration anesthesia administered around #13 region.

Surgical Procedure

  • Patient cleaned and draped under aseptic protocol.

  • Incision made and operculum overlying #13 removed.

  • 980nm Diode Laser used to recontour soft tissue and achieve hemostasis.

  • Vitamin E applied over the surgical site.

  • Post-operative instructions provided.

Post-operative Assessment

  • Post-op photographs taken.

  • Minimal bleeding, satisfactory healing observed.

  • Patient tolerated procedure well.
